TitleLetter from Lord John Russell to Prince Albert
Date5 April 1854
WriterRussell, John, Lord
AddresseeAlbert of Saxe Coburg and Gotha, Prince
DescriptionLetter from Lord John Russell to Prince Albert acknowledging Queen Victoria's anxiety over Home Affairs and reporting that he was to attend a meeting with Lord Aberdeen and Sir James Graham that day. He states that he will be able to visit the Prince after the meeting.
Place Of WritingChesham Place
